WebA cage trap needs to be large enough to hold the raccoon, and most raccoon-size cage traps are at least 32 inches long and 12 inches high and wide. WebSep 16, 2024 · A good bait choice for raccoons is fish, which can be wrapped in mesh and tied to the back of the cage so the raccoon can’t reach around the trap’s trigger pedal and take it, according to Ortiz. “They like fish,” he said. “Whenever we get a trap-shy raccoon that doesn’t want to go into the traps, we use a piece of salmon. Put your snares in, bring your water to a boil, add half a box of baking soda and let boil for 5 - 10 minutes. how to buy a dry cleaning businessWebJun 21, 2016 · Hang some bait behind the trigger pan from the top of the trap. This can be done with a piece of wire, a zip-tie, etc. The purpose of putting bait in this position is to get the raccoon to not focus on the floor of the trap where the trigger pan is. The hanging bait gets their attention and causes them to work a little harder to get the treat. how to buy ads on social mediaWebJun 18, 2024 · (WKBN) – The Ohio Department of Natural Resources talked about what you can do to deal with a raccoon infestation after an issue in Boardman between a man and his neighbors.
